DAY 02 YANGON / MANDALAY (BY FLIGHT)
Breakfast at hotel, transfer to the airport to fly to Mandalay, the last
capital of Myanmar Monarchs. From airport to Ancient Capital
Amarapura, 11 Kilometers south of Mandalay visiting Mahagandayon
monastery; 1.2 kilometer long U Bein Wooden Bridge and
silk-weaving factory. Hotel check in. Late afternoon visit Maha Muni Buddha Image and
continue to Golden Monastery (Shwe Kyaung), a monastery once King Mindon’s royal
palace apartment for meditation. At last,
enjoying the sunset from the Mandalay Hill, a vantage point for
the panoramic view of Mandalay. Overnight in Mandalay.

DAY 04 BAGAN
Morning sightseeing begins with a visit to the Nyaung Oo Market;
next to Shwezigon Pagoda, the prototype of later Myanmar stupas; Wetkyee-inn Gubyaukgyi Temple, with fine mural paintings of jataka scenes;
Htilominlo Temple, noted for its plaster carvings and visit
lacquerware factory before or after lunch. Late afternoon visit to Ananda Temple, an
architectural masterpiece resembling a Greek Cross; and
Thanbinnnyu, the highest of Bagan Temples ; and Bu paya, a Pyu
style pagoda on the brink of the majestic Ayeyarwaddy River.
Overnight in Bagan.
